コード例 #1
0
        //Bind your Grid View here
        private void BindTaskList(int PromoterID, string FromMonth, string ToMonth, int CurrentYear, int IsAll)
        {
            clsPromotionFactory fac = new clsPromotionFactory();
            int       pageNumber    = Convert.ToInt32(ViewState["PageNumber"]);
            int       PageSize      = 100;
            string    sortcolumn    = ViewState["SortColumn"].ToString();
            DataSet   Promoter      = fac.GetSongByPromoterID(PromoterID, FromMonth, ToMonth, CurrentYear, 0, pageNumber, PageSize, sortcolumn, null);
            DataTable myDataTable   = Promoter.Tables[0]; //Set your DataTable here

            ViewState["Count"] = Promoter.Tables[1];
            grd.DataSource     = myDataTable;
            grd.DataBind();
        }
コード例 #2
0
        protected void btnComplete_Click(object sender, EventArgs e)
        {
            int PromoterID          = Convert.ToInt32(hdnID.Value);
            clsPromotionFactory fac = new clsPromotionFactory();
            int     pageNumber      = Convert.ToInt32(ViewState["PageNumber"]);
            int     PageSize        = 100;
            string  sortcolumn      = ViewState["SortColumn"].ToString();
            DataSet Promter         = fac.GetSongByPromoterID(PromoterID, string.Empty, string.Empty, DateTime.Now.Year, 1, pageNumber, PageSize, sortcolumn, null);

            DataTable myDataTable = Promter.Tables[0]; //Set your DataTable here

            grd.DataSource = myDataTable;
            grd.DataBind();
        }
コード例 #3
0
        protected void btnSearch_Click(object sender, EventArgs e)
        {
            string FromMonths = ddlFrom.SelectedItem.Value;
            string ToMonths   = ddlTo.SelectedItem.Value;

            if (!string.IsNullOrEmpty(FromMonths))
            {
                string[] FromArr   = FromMonths.Split('_');
                string   FromMonth = FromArr[0].ToString();

                string[] ToArr   = ToMonths.Split('_');
                string   ToMonth = ToArr[0].ToString();

                int PromoterID          = Convert.ToInt32(hdnID.Value);
                int YearName            = Convert.ToInt32(FromArr[1].ToString());
                clsPromotionFactory fac = new clsPromotionFactory();

                int    pageNumber = Convert.ToInt32(ViewState["PageNumber"]);
                int    PageSize   = 100;
                string sortcolumn = ViewState["SortColumn"].ToString();

                DataSet Promter = fac.GetSongByPromoterID(PromoterID, FromMonth, ToMonth, YearName, 0, pageNumber, PageSize, sortcolumn, null);

                DataTable myDataTable = Promter.Tables[0]; //Set your DataTable here

                grd.DataSource = myDataTable;
                grd.DataBind();
            }
            else
            {
                int      PromoterID  = Convert.ToInt32(hdnID.Value);
                DateTime Currentdate = DateTime.Now;
                int      CurrentYear = Currentdate.Year;


                string CurrentMonth = Currentdate.ToString("MMMM");
                string FromMonth    = (CurrentMonth == "gennaio" ? "January" : CurrentMonth == "febbraio" ? "February" : CurrentMonth == "marzo" ? "March" : CurrentMonth == "aprile" ? "April" : CurrentMonth == "maggio" ? "May" : CurrentMonth == "giugno" ? "June" : CurrentMonth == "luglio" ? "July" : CurrentMonth == "agosto" ? "August" : CurrentMonth == "settembre" ? "September" : CurrentMonth == "ottobre" ? "October" : CurrentMonth == "novembre" ? "November" : CurrentMonth == "dicembre" ? "December" : CurrentMonth);

                string ToMonth = FromMonth;

                BindTaskList(PromoterID, FromMonth, ToMonth, CurrentYear, 0);
            }
        }